A childcare provider in the UK is seeking a Nursery Room Leader to help formulate aims and objectives in Early Years education. This full-time position requires NVQ Level 3 in Early Years or equivalent, with responsibilities including sharing updates with staff and collaborating on school improvement.

The role offers a gross salary of £29,120.00 per annum, with a schedule of Monday to Friday, ensuring a structured environment for children’s learning.

How to prepare for a job interview at Tinies

✨Know Your Early Years Framework

Make sure you’re well-versed in the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S) framework. Familiarise yourself with its principles and how they apply to your teaching style. This will show that you’re not just qualified, but also passionate about early years education.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ect questions that ask how you would handle specific situations in a nursery setting. Think of examples from your past experience where you successfully managed a challenging situation or improved a child's learning experience. This will demonstrate your practical skills and problem-solving abilities.

✨Showcase Your Teamwork Skills

As a Nursery Room Leader, collaboration is key. Be ready to discuss how you’ve worked with other staff members to achieve common goals. Highlight any experiences where you’ve contributed to school improvement or shared updates effectively with your team.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the nursery’s approach to curriculum development or how they support staff professional growth.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
